What is the legend of Multnomah Falls?Īccording to the Native American legend from the Multnomah tribe, the waterfall was formed after a young woman sacrificed herself to the Great Spirit to save Multnomah village from a plague by jumping from the cliff. The falls drop in two major steps, split into an upper fall of 542 feet (165 m) and a lower fall of 69 feet (21 m), with a gradual 9-foot (3 m) drop in elevation between the two. The structure of Multnomah Falls is divided into two parts, spanning two tiers on basalt cliffs. Multnomah Falls height is 620 feet (189 m) and is listed as the 156th tallest waterfall in the United States by the World Waterfall Database. It’s a dream location for waterfall lovers.
